What makes Indian-context shoots convert
Local detail is the conversion lever. Indian audiences instantly recognise a Sarojini-style street market, a Kerala backwater, a Mumbai local train, a Diwali-lit balcony — and recognition builds trust faster than any caption. Specific outfits (kanjeevaram, Patiala salwar, oversized college hoodie), specific settings (chai tapri, Connaught Place, Marine Drive) and specific light (golden hour, festive diya glow, monsoon overcast) make the difference between "AI slop" and "an influencer I'd follow."

Festive & Ethnic
1. Diwali balcony glow — Lighting diyas on a railing at dusk.
Deep-red Banarasi saree, gold jewellery, lighting clay diyas on a balcony railing, string-light bokeh, warm golden-hour glow.
2. Karva Chauth moon shot — Looking up through a sieve at the moon.
Maroon-and-gold lehenga, henna hands, holding a decorated sieve up toward a full moon, candlelit terrace, cool moonlight.
3. Navratri garba energy — Mid-twirl in a mirror-work chaniya choli.
Vibrant pink mirror-work chaniya choli mid-spin, dandiya sticks, blurred festive crowd and fairy lights, evening event lighting.
4. Onam pookalam morning — Kneeling beside a flower rangoli.
Cream-and-gold Kerala kasavu saree, arranging a circular flower pookalam on a tiled courtyard floor, soft diffused morning light.
5. Eid evening portrait — Soft-glam in a pastel anarkali.
Pastel-lilac embroidered anarkali, delicate jhumkas, by a carved wooden door, warm string-light bokeh, gentle evening glow.
Street & Travel India
6. Sarojini market haul — Bargaining with bags in hand.
Casual denim and printed crop top, shopping bags in both hands, mid-laugh in a crowded Delhi street market, bright overcast daylight.
7. Marine Drive sunset — Sitting on the sea wall at golden hour.
White linen trousers, tan shirt, sitting on the Marine Drive wall, Mumbai skyline behind, golden-hour backlight, wind in her hair.
8. Jaipur heritage alley — Walking through a pink-sandstone lane.
Mustard kurta, oxidised silver jewellery, hand brushing a pink-sandstone Jaipur wall, warm midday sun, earthy heritage tones.
9. Goa scooter day — Beach-bound on an Activa.
Flowy beach dress and sunglasses on a scooter on a palm-lined Goa road, ocean in the distance, bright tropical sunlight.
10. Kerala backwater boat — On a houseboat deck.
Relaxed cotton kurti, reclining on a wooden houseboat deck, green backwaters and coconut palms behind, soft hazy afternoon light.
11. Mumbai local train window — The classic commuter frame.
Office-casual wear at the open door of a moving Mumbai local, hair flying, motion-blurred greenery outside, candid documentary feel.
Cafe & Lifestyle
12. Filter coffee cafe — Cosy corner with a steel tumbler.
Oversized beige sweater, holding a steel tumbler of filter coffee in a rustic Bangalore cafe, warm wooden interior, soft window light.
13. Brunch flatlay co-star — Hands and food in frame.
Pastel co-ord set at a marble cafe table with avocado toast and iced coffee, soft top-down light, bright airy lifestyle framing.
14. Work-from-cafe — Laptop, journal, latte.
Smart-casual, typing on a laptop at a sunlit cafe window seat, journal and latte beside her, warm morning light through glass.
15. Rainy-day window chai — Monsoon mood indoors.
Knit cardigan, holding masala chai by a rain-streaked window, blurred wet street outside, soft overcast monsoon light, warm tones.
16. Reading nook at home — Slow-living aesthetic.
Linen loungewear, curled in a cane chair with a book and plants around her, soft diffused daylight, calm minimalist interior.
Fitness & Wellness
17. Sunrise rooftop yoga — Warrior pose at dawn.
Fitted teal activewear, warrior yoga pose on a city rooftop at sunrise, soft pink-orange sky, long morning shadows, calm wide shot.
18. Gym strength shot — Mid-workout, candid.
Black athleisure, mid-dumbbell curl in a modern gym, soft directional lighting, slight sweat sheen, focused determined look.
19. Morning run in the park — Movement and energy.
Coral running gear, jogging on a tree-lined park path at dawn, motion in stride, golden backlight through leaves, candid action frame.
20. Healthy smoothie kitchen — Wellness lifestyle.
Fitted tank top, holding a green smoothie in a bright modern kitchen, fruit on the counter, clean natural daylight, airy aesthetic.
21. Meditation corner — Calm and grounded.
Soft grey loungewear, seated cross-legged in meditation by a window with plants and a candle, gentle light, muted serene tones.
Product & UGC
22. Skincare unboxing — Holding the product to camera.
White robe, fresh face, holding a skincare bottle toward the camera in a bright bathroom, soft even lighting, clean beauty UGC framing.
23. Hands-only product demo — Texture and detail shot.
Close-up of hands swatching a face cream on the wrist, soft window light, neutral background, crisp focus on the product texture.
24. Fashion try-on mirror — Outfit-of-the-day selfie.
Full-length mirror selfie in a trendy ethnic-fusion outfit, phone in hand, well-lit bedroom with a clothing rack behind, OOTD vibe.
25. Jewellery close-up — Festive product hero.
Close-up portrait wearing statement gold jhumkas and a maang tikka, soft side lighting catching the metal, blurred warm festive background.
26. Food-brand tasting reaction — Authentic UGC bite.
Casual wear, taking a bite of a packaged snack at a kitchen counter, delighted reaction, product in frame, bright friendly daylight.

Seasonal
27. Monsoon umbrella street — Rain-soaked romance.
Yellow raincoat, transparent umbrella on a wet city street, rain falling, reflective puddles, soft grey monsoon light, moody cinematic tone.
28. Winter Delhi morning — Layered and cosy.
Chunky knit shawl and boots, holding chai in a fog-covered Delhi park, bare winter trees, soft hazy morning light, warm seasonal mood.
29. Summer mango aesthetic — Bright Indian summer.
Breezy yellow sundress, holding fresh mangoes in a sunny courtyard, vivid summer colours, harsh daylight softened by shade, cheerful vibe.
30. Holi colour burst — Festive playful action.
White kurta splashed with pink and yellow gulal, mid-laugh, colour powder in the air, blurred festive crowd, high-energy candid action shot.
Putting it into a content calendar
Don't shoot these at random. Batch by theme — one festive set, one cafe set, one fitness set per week — and you have a month of varied content without repeating a backdrop. Keep the same persona face across all of them so every post reinforces the same recognisable individual; that consistency is what turns a feed of images into a followable creator.
